#DCC77B Hex color

#DCC77B

The hexadecimal color code #DCC77B corresponds to the code RGB( 220, 199, 123 ). It's a shade of Yellow. This color is a combination of red (at 0,86 level), green (at 0,78 level) and blue (at 0,48 level). Its brightness is 67% and its saturation is 58%. It is composed of red at 40%, green at 36% and blue at 22%.
